In Nova Scotia, the Waves Are Fast and the Food Is Slow | Bon Appétit

"A small, sweet, brunch-focused spot that blends French classics with diner comfort: expect flaky quiche and croque-monsieurs, house-made brioche stacked with honey-caramelized ham and finished with a torched béarnaise, and pasta-driven evening dishes. The menu leans on seasonal produce from a nearby urban farm and features dishes like fresh tagliatelle tossed with pungent pink oyster mushrooms in a rich cream sauce and sunny tomatoes on garlic-rubbed sourdough." - ByMelissa Buote

Absolutely love this place! Such great coffee and pastries (photos from this trip were just prior to closing so they had sold out of pastries/goodies). They roast their own beans and sell multiple bags and flavours under the name ‘Have Fun Coffee’ one of the few local roasters that do unique more fruity flavour profiles. They are the only local cafe I have found who sell high quality coffee beans from other roasters around the world. They recently expanded the space and now have a large seating area. The space is open and bright, the vibes are great and the coffee is delicious.
